在互联网时代,海量的网页和数据对于用户来说是灿烂无比的宝藏。而对于开发者和数据分析师来说,获取和处理这些数据则是他们的重要工作。而爬虫,作为一种常用的数据获取工具,其中的PHP爬虫就是一种非常有效的手段。
那么,PHP爬虫的原理是什么呢?简单来说,PHP爬虫是通过自动化程序访问网页,并解析网页中的标签和数据信息,实现网页的自动化抓取。具体来说,PHP爬虫的原理分为以下几个步骤:
- 选择目标:确定要爬取的目标网站或网页。
- 发送请求:使用PHP发送HTTP请求到目标网站,获取网页的HTML内容。
- 解析网页:通过使用DOM解析器或正则表达式解析网页的HTML代码,筛选出所需的标签和数据。
- 保存数据:将解析所得的数据保存到数据库或者本地文件中。
通过这些步骤,PHP爬虫可以实现自动抓取和解析网页中的数据信息,实现对海量数据的处理和利用。
PHP爬虫的应用也非常广泛。举几个例子,PHP爬虫可以用于:
- 数据采集:获取网站上的商品价格、新闻文章等信息。
- 搜索引擎优化:抓取搜索引擎排名,分析竞争对手网站的关键词等。
- 信息监控:监控特定网站的数据,如新闻更新、股票行情等。
- 数据分析:获取大量用户评论、社交媒体数据等进行分析。
总之,PHP爬虫的原理和应用让我们能够更高效地获取和处理互联网上的海量数据,为开发者和分析人员提供了强大的工具和利润。